Definition of Buoyant

Buoy´ant
a.1.Having the quality of rising or floating in a fluid; tending to rise or float; as, iron is buoyant in mercury.
2.Bearing up, as a fluid; sustaining another body by being specifically heavier.
The water under me was buoyant.
- Dryden.
3.Light-hearted; vivacious; cheerful; as, a buoyant disposition; buoyant spirits.
